Transaction 1ebefc0a132e13b5d9d3d5b5fae00511b288a19136fc68d6ec2fcc3ffd60bb68

1 Input
1 Outputs
  • 1ebefc0a132e13b5d9d3d5b5fae00511b288a19136fc68d6ec2fcc3ffd60bb68:0
  • value  19801059
    address  1HDWAto9mD4vwZkxE7RZ4nxvgYcA5vJQpG